Jack C. Piper, age 88, of Sumner, Illinois passed away on Tuesday, August 18, 2020 at his residence surrounded by his family. He was born on February 13, 1932 in Olney, Illinois, the son of Marion X. and Nettie Bell (Williams) Piper. On February 24, 1952 he married the love of his life, Jewel A. Wheeler, and they spent 68 wonderful years together.

Jack was an ironworker for 45 years and served his country with the United States Army. He was a member of the Iron Workers Local # 22 and the Sumner United Methodist Church. His hobbies included hunting and fishing, as well as mushroom and ginseng hunting. He will be remembered as a wonderful husband, father, and papa.
